[gtk] (51 commits) Non-fast-forward update to branch matthiasc/color-profile-rebased



The branch 'matthiasc/color-profile-rebased' was changed in a way that was not a fast-forward update.
NOTE: This may cause problems for people pulling from the branch. For more information,
please see:

 https://wiki.gnome.org/Git/Help/NonFastForward

Commits removed from the branch:

  b8b5b07... gdk: Add GdkColorSpace
  4a67674... cms: Add lcms to the build
  52783f2... Add an lcms2 subproject
  fce194e... ci: Update dependencies for msys
  da02883... Add mutter and lcms2-devel to the Fedora image
  121150a... gdk: Add GdkLcmsColorSpace
  4830c2f... API: Add a GdkTexture::color-space property
  7d23643... API: Add gdk_memory_texture_new_with_color_space()
  796ed90... jpeg: Add color space support
  0392172... widget-factory: Add gradient rendering test
  7b6981e... gtk-demo: Add a color space demo
  1f11ab0... API: Add GdkSurface::color-space
  1a5666c... API: Add color space get/set for cairo
  d338cfb... memoryformat: Take a color space when converting
  c00bfe8... gdk: Take a color space in gdk_texture_download_surface
  29658b2... gdk: Take a color space in gdk_memory_texture_from_texture
  809c3a3... png: Handle color spaces
  06a6c4e... tiff: Add color space support
  723a088... gsk: Avoid cairo in icon upload
  37079f5... memoryformat: Do some gdk_memory_convert() massaging
  b27281a... memoryformat: Optimize more
  880d737... lcmscolorspace: Implement a global transform cache
  4aee42f... widget-factory: Add tests for loading color profiles
  387ba65... Support color space in pixbufs
  7f4be72... x11: Implement support for color profiles
  15e5345... Add crude color management impl for cairo
  9895eec... gdk: Add GDK_DEBUG=srgb
  cd69604... gsk: Upload textures in linear sRGB
  f03c51b... gsk: Apply gamma to frames
  d77e1e7... gsk: Linearize colors too
  3c0fc56... gsk: Linearize gl textures
  57eb7e7... gsk: Use stem darkening for glyphs
  b4cfe92... cairo: Use stem darkening for glyphs
  23de8d9... gsk: Fix caching of textures
  77e6c3c... gsk: Refactor a bit
  f4db510... gsk: Do texture conversions in shaders
  31660b6... gsk: Support flipping gl textures
  17d35e8... API: Add a new constructor for GL textures
  30b62ff... gsk: Use GL texture information
  64ed3dc... glarea: Use the new GL texture constructor
  8dcd5f4... media: Use the new GL texture constructor
  d12383f... gdk: Introduce GdkColor
  7a56bc1... gsk: Add color space in gsk_renderer_render_texture
  b96857b... wip: update testsuite for changed compositing
  77d7eb1... wip: Add a cicp color space implementation
  5275d55... Add libheif to the build
  d66838c... Add a quick-and-dirty heif loading test
  bfc85c8... widget-factory: Add an hdr image example

Commits added to the branch:

  87fcac7... gdk: Add GdkColorSpace
  6979811... cms: Add lcms to the build
  588a721... Add an lcms2 subproject
  b286901... ci: Update dependencies for msys
  28d70d1... Add mutter and lcms2-devel to the Fedora image
  28f670d... gdk: Add GdkLcmsColorSpace
  9b824ab... Add some colorspace tests
  e675b54... API: Add a GdkTexture::color-space property
  157ad46... API: Add gdk_memory_texture_new_with_color_space()
  23fdeb9... jpeg: Add color space support
  69403eb... widget-factory: Add gradient rendering test
  e9315db... gtk-demo: Add a color space demo
  d546785... API: Add GdkSurface::color-space
  d161830... API: Add color space get/set for cairo
  03c9e25... memoryformat: Take a color space when converting
  f1e3ccf... gdk: Take a color space in gdk_texture_download_surface
  8fd866b... gdk: Take a color space in gdk_memory_texture_from_texture
  9ceaf34... png: Handle color spaces
  3214e5a... tiff: Add color space support
  d2f9acf... gsk: Avoid cairo in icon upload
  c5909b1... memoryformat: Do some gdk_memory_convert() massaging
  b4116cb... memoryformat: Optimize more
  4137f26... lcmscolorspace: Implement a global transform cache
  f0e2e58... widget-factory: Add tests for loading color profiles
  2880a9c... Support color space in pixbufs
  3ce7556... x11: Implement support for color profiles
  91ffa97... Add crude color management impl for cairo
  ff78a91... gdk: Add GDK_DEBUG=srgb
  d9e6e92... gsk: Upload textures in linear sRGB
  7e91c15... gsk: Apply gamma to frames
  fda050e... gsk: Linearize colors too
  830892e... gsk: Linearize gl textures
  b09c642... gsk: Use stem darkening for glyphs
  ca062df... cairo: Use stem darkening for glyphs
  7371840... gsk: Fix caching of textures
  616a9e1... gsk: Refactor a bit
  0e0bb92... gsk: Do texture conversions in shaders
  f7268a5... gsk: Support flipping gl textures
  55179c4... API: Add a new constructor for GL textures
  80bf233... gsk: Use GL texture information
  77280d2... glarea: Use the new GL texture constructor
  623cdaf... media: Use the new GL texture constructor
  31b9e8d... gdk: Introduce GdkColor
  82b4500... gsk: Add color space in gsk_renderer_render_texture
  6e75db7... wip: update testsuite for changed compositing
  1b83c44... wip: Add a cicp color space implementation
  966a150... Add libheif to the build
  17b7e98... Add a quick-and-dirty heif loading test
  b6eb23a... widget-factory: Add an hdr image example
  fde2fef... testsuite: Compare textures properly
  6cb3300... Add a test for color conversion


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]